These are two sets of the writ petitions, out of which first five writ petitions have been filed against the judgment and order dated March 18, 2005 and last two writ petitions have been filed against different common judgment and order dated March 3, 2005. Both the orders and judgments have been passed by the Orissa Administrative Tribunal, Bhubaneswar and Cuttack respectively in different original applications.
(2.) Since in all these cases, the impugned orders are based on interpretation of "teaching experience" as defined in 3(k) of the Orissa Medical Education Service (Recruitment) Rules 1979 (hereinafter referred to as "the Rules, 1979" ),they are being disposed of by this common judgment.
